‘Return must be voluntary’, UN on Pakistan’s plan to evict Afghan refugees

Pakistan plans to deport 1.1m refugees, including Afghans, by Nov 1.

The United Nations said that refugees residing in Pakistan should be allowed to exit the country voluntarily and no pressure should be exerted on them.

“Any refugee return must be voluntary and without any pressure to ensure protection for those seeking safety,” Qaisar Khan Afridi, a spokesman for the UN High Commissioner for Refugees.

The UNHCR official termed the press reports about a plan to deport undocumented Afghans “disconcerting” and said the body was seeking clarity from “our government partners”.

Afridi asked Pakistan to come up with a plan that ensures all Afghan nations with international protection are not deported, noting that Islamabad has been “generously hosting refugees for more than 40 years”.
